Bitget Opens 2026 Graduate Program to Build the Next Billion Minds


Victoria, Seychelles, 15 September 2025—Bitget, the world’s leading cryptocurrency exchange and Web3 company, is opening applications for its 2026 Graduate Program, a global track under Bitget’s Blockchain4Youth initiative, recruiting next-generation talent from top universities and placing them directly into real Web3 workstreams.
The timeline is quick: applications open today, interviews begin in October, offers are delivered in December, and onboarding starts in 2026. Graduates will rotate across high-impact teams with senior mentorship and hands-on ownership, with over 50 roles available in engineering, product management, business development, growth, branding, operations, data analytics, algorithm, and risk control. To kick off the season, Blockchain4Youth and Blockchain4Her, two CSR initiatives launched by Bitget, will co-host a Web3 diversity career session at Hong Kong University of Science and Technology (HKUST) on 20 September together with the 0xU student community. Bitget employees will share their professional experiences, discuss case studies, and connect one-on-one with candidates who want to build at the intersection of finance, technology, and culture.
Bitget is looking for proactive self-starters who are curious, inventive, and comfortable working across cultures. A genuine interest in AI and Web3 is essential. In return, graduates join one of the world’s fastest-growing exchanges, collaborate with colleagues from more than 50 countries, and advance through a clear development path that combines rotations, mentorship, competitive compensation, and the chance to ship on the frontier.
Anchored in Bitget’s Blockchain4Youth initiative, the Graduate Program is more than a hiring track; it’s a runway into Web3 built around workshops, campus salons, and hands-on mentorship that help graduates ship real products and grow inside a global community. The program sits within B4Y’s broader education roadmap, which pairs early-career opportunities with practical learning to turn literacy into independence and innovation.
